Copyright and P2P: Global collision, national responses
- Patricia Akester | Cambridge University
The talk will focus on the different legal issues involved in ascertaining whether those whose business is based on the exploitation of P2P enabling software should bear liability for copyright infringement, aiming to establish whether the common features and patterns of evolution which are emerging in the field have led to a dogmatic sense of global legal certainty.
